| // MARKER(update_precomp.py): autogen include statement, do not remove |
| #include "precompiled_basegfx.hxx" |
| #include <basegfx/numeric/ftools.hxx> |
| #include <algorithm> |
| |
| namespace basegfx |
| { |
| // init static member of class fTools |
| double ::basegfx::fTools::mfSmallValue = 0.000000001; |
| |
| double snapToNearestMultiple(double v, const double fStep) |
| { |
| if(fTools::equalZero(fStep)) |
| { |
| // with a zero step, all snaps to 0.0 |
| return 0.0; |
| } |
| else |
| { |
| const double fHalfStep(fStep * 0.5); |
| const double fChange(fHalfStep - fmod(v + fHalfStep, fStep)); |
| |
| if(basegfx::fTools::equal(fabs(v), fabs(fChange))) |
| { |
| return 0.0; |
| } |
| else |
| { |
| return v + fChange; |
| } |
| } |
| } |
| |
| double snapToZeroRange(double v, double fWidth) |
| { |
| if(fTools::equalZero(fWidth)) |
| { |
| // with no range all snaps to range bound |
| return 0.0; |
| } |
| else |
| { |
| if(v < 0.0 || v > fWidth) |
| { |
| double fRetval(fmod(v, fWidth)); |
| |
| if(fRetval < 0.0) |
| { |
| fRetval += fWidth; |
| } |
| |
| return fRetval; |
| } |
| else |
| { |
| return v; |
| } |
| } |
| } |
| |
| double snapToRange(double v, double fLow, double fHigh) |
| { |
| if(fTools::equal(fLow, fHigh)) |
| { |
| // with no range all snaps to range bound |
| return 0.0; |
| } |
| else |
| { |
| if(fLow > fHigh) |
| { |
| // correct range order. Evtl. assert this (?) |
| std::swap(fLow, fHigh); |
| } |
| |
| if(v < fLow || v > fHigh) |
| { |
| return snapToZeroRange(v - fLow, fHigh - fLow) + fLow; |
| } |
| else |
| { |
| return v; |
| } |
| } |
| } |
| } // end of namespace basegfx |
